Flex Fraud on the Rise

Fraudsters are increasingly targeting people using the convenience of flexible spending accounts (FSAs) and health savings accounts (HSAs). This new trend, known as flex fraud, involves criminals misappropriating funds from these accounts through clever schemes. To protect yourself from becoming a victim, it's essential to be aware of the common tactics used by flex fraudsters and implement preventative measures.

  • Review your account statements regularly for any suspicious activity.{Keep a close eye on your online accounts and report any unauthorized transactions immediately.Be vigilant about phishing attempts that aim to steal your login credentials.
  • Use strong passwords and multi-factor authentication to protect your accounts. Choose unique passwords for each of your financial accounts and enable two-factor authentication whenever possible.Implement robust security measures, such as biometric logins or hardware tokens.
